jeremybryce

Top end soundbars have pretty good separation these days. They're phyiscally super wide and have side firing L/R + L/R + C, up-firing L/R + rear satellite surrounds SL/SR + up-firing SR/SL. Plus a 12inch sub, or two. Giving you 11.2.4 / 7.1.4 etc. With actual discrete speakers. For $1200-$1600 it covers a lot of ground in a small space and Atmos sounds pretty damn good. You're right about standalone setups, but to get those amount of channels with decent sound, you're spending a lot and taking a lot more space.

mattsowa

It really isn't, but it kinda comes down to calibration. You need to make it a good brightness, smooth but responsive, etc. Maybe it was a little distracting in the beginning to me but now it's just so good. Watched interstellar recently and the flashing scenes added an incredible amount of immersion as my whole room felt like inside of the movie. Note though, my setup is different. I basically put led strips on the back of my tv and used HyperHDR for the software. I can see how OP's setup could be worse for the long term

I have various ambilight setups on every TV & gaming PC for about 8 years now, cant live without them. Yes they look distracting at first but you quickly forget about them, and its WAY nicer to look at than some blazing bright box against a dark background (my rooms are almost always very dark). I dont really like this setup though, 2 lights set to the side like this is not ideal, and definitely not for a big couch gaming rooms like this. I would at minimum have the lights behind the TV so the lighting emits from it (although it looks like floor lamps so that probably isnt possible). If possible they'd get a string/lightstrip around the rim but those are more difficult to setup on a TV as opposed to very easy on a PC.
